UN Rights Chief Demands End To 'Carnage' Amid Israel's Gaza City Assault
The UN rights chief on Tuesday condemned Israel's ground assault on Gaza City as "utterly unacceptable", demanding an end to the "carnage" and warning of growing evidence of genocide in the Palestinian territory.
Earlier on Tuesday, the Israeli army said it had launched a ground invasion of Gaza City.
